The Israeli military has announced that it has struck a military compound of Unit 4400, which it described as the “logistical reinforcement unit of the terrorist organization Hezbollah”, in the Baalbek area of northern Lebanon.
In addition, it said it carried out strikes on the Itatron area of southern Lebanon, including a military site and two military buildings belonging to Hezbollah.
It said the attacks were carried out in “response to the downing of an [Israeli military] helicopter” over Lebanon on Monday night.
Earlier, we reported that the Israeli military killed three Hezbollah members in an air attack on a convoy of tankers in the Hermel district of northern Lebanon on the border with Syria, according to a military source from the Lebanese group.
